Einzelnen Beitrag anzeigen

snock

Registriert seit: 22. Jun 2004
Ort: Ravensburg
23 Beiträge
 
#3

Re: FTP mit (Client)Socket, Problem mit LIST

  Alt 22. Aug 2004, 10:19
Nein habe keine Firewall aktiv, mit SmartFTP gehts ja.
Und ich kann ja auf den Server vebinden und Befehle ausführen.

Das hier sende ich:
Delphi-Quellcode:
procedure Tftpwin.ftpConnect(Sender: TObject; Socket: TCustomWinSocket);
begin
Socket.SendText('USER '+username+#13#10);
Socket.SendText('PASS '+password+#13#10);
//Socket.SendText('SYST'+#13#10);
//Socket.SendText('REST 100'+#13#10);
//Socket.SendText('REST 0'+#13#10);
//Socket.SendText('PWD'+#13#10);
//Socket.SendText('TYPE A'+#13#10);
Socket.SendText('PASV'+#13#10);
Socket.SendText('LIST -aL'+#13#10);
//Socket.SendText('NOOP'+#13#10); }
end;
SmartFTP lässt die Befehle (in Reihenfolge) ausführen:
USER
PASS
SYST
REST 100
REST 0
PWD
TYPE A
PASV
LIST -aL
NOOP

- auch wenn ich sie so ausführen lasse kommt das mit "425 Can't build data connection: Connection refused."



Vielen Dnak im Vorraus


mfg snock
Alles hat ein Ende nur die Wurst hat zwei.
  Mit Zitat antworten Zitat